Project 2 General Objectives 

 Project 2 - Map class, Comparator, sorting 

  1. Use the JDK Map class to write more efficient code when constructing the internal data structures from the data file.
  2. Implement SORTING using the Comparator interface together with the JDK support for sorting data structures, thus sorting on different fields of the classes from Project 1.
  3. Extend the GUI from Project 1 to let the user sort the data at run-time.
